The vivo S30 lands as a mid-range contender that punches above its weight, blending a slim 7.5 mm chassis with a sizeable 6500 mAh silicon-carbon battery and a triple rear camera system anchored by a periscope telephoto. Announced on May 29, 2025, it targets buyers who want flagship-style imaging features and long endurance without stepping into premium price territory.

Powered by the Qualcomm Snapdragon 7 Gen 4 and shipping with Android 15 under OriginOS 5, the S30 carries model number V2464A and starts at roughly 330 EUR. This article breaks down what the spec sheet means in everyday use and where the S30 fits against its rivals.

Full Specifications

Network

Technology GSM / CDMA / HSPA / LTE / 5G
2G bands GSM 850 / 900 / 1800 / 1900
CDMA 800
3G bands HSDPA 800 / 850 / 900 / 1700(AWS) / 1900 / 2100
4G bands 1, 3, 4, 5, 7, 8, 18, 19, 26, 28, 34, 38, 39, 40, 41, 42, 43, 48, 66
5G bands 1, 3, 5, 7, 8, 18, 26, 28, 38, 40, 41, 48, 66, 77, 78 SA/NSA
Speed HSPA, LTE, 5G

Launch

Announced 2025, May 29
Status Available. Released 2025, May 29

Body

Dimensions 160.2 x 74.4 x 7.5 mm (6.31 x 2.93 x 0.30 in)
Weight 192 g (6.77 oz)
Build Glass front (Diamond Shield Glass), plastic frame, glass back
SIM Nano-SIM + Nano-SIM
Water-proof

Display

Type AMOLED, 1B colors, 120Hz, 3840Hz PWM, HDR, 1300 nits (HBM), 5000 nits (peak)
Size 6.67 inches, 107.4 cm2 (~90.1% screen-to-body ratio)
Resolution 1260 x 2800 pixels, 20:9 ratio (~460 ppi density)
Protection Diamond Shield Glass

Platform

OS Android 15, OriginOS 5
Chipset Qualcomm SM7750-AB Snapdragon 7 Gen 4 (4 nm)
CPU Octa-core (1×2.8 GHz Cortex-720 & 4×2.4 GHz Cortex-720 & 3×1.8 GHz Cortex-520)
GPU Adreno 722

Memory

Card slot No
Internal 256GB 12GB RAM, 512GB 12GB RAM, 512GB 16GB RAM
UFS 2.2

Main Camera

Triple 50 MP, f/1.9, 23mm (wide), 1/1.56", PDAF, OIS 50 MP, f/2.7, 70mm (periscope telephoto), 1/1.95", PDAF, OIS, 3x optical zoom 8 MP, f/2.2, 106˚ (ultrawide)
Features Ring-LED flash, panorama, HDR
Video 4K, 1080p, gyro-EIS

Selfie camera

Single 50 MP, f/2.0, 22mm (wide), AF
Features HDR
Video 4K, 1080p

Sound

Loudspeaker Yes, with stereo speakers
3.5mm jack No

Comms

WLAN Wi-Fi 802.11 a/b/g/n/ac/6, dual-band
Bluetooth 5.4, A2DP, LE, aptX HD, aptX Adaptive, aptX Lossless, LHDC 5
Positioning GPS, GALILEO, GLONASS, QZSS, BDS (B1I+B1c)
NFC Yes
Infrared port Yes
Radio No
USB USB Type-C 2.0, OTG

Features

Sensors Fingerprint (under display, optical), accelerometer, gyro, proximity, compass

Battery

Type Si/C Li-Ion 6500 mAh
Charging 90W wired, PD Reverse wired Bypass charging

Misc

Colors Black, Blue, Yellow, Pink
Models V2464A
Price About 330 EUR

Design and Build Quality

Measuring 160.2 x 74.4 x 7.5 mm and tipping the scales at 192 g, the S30 is notably thin for a phone with a 6500 mAh cell. The construction pairs a Diamond Shield Glass front with a plastic frame and a glass back, and vivo offers it in Black, Blue, Yellow, and Pink. The phone is also listed as water-resistant, which adds peace of mind for everyday use. Dual Nano-SIM support keeps it travel-friendly, though there is no microSD expansion.

Display and Visual Experience

The 6.67-inch AMOLED panel runs at 1260 x 2800 pixels with a 20:9 aspect ratio for roughly 460 ppi. A 120 Hz refresh rate keeps scrolling smooth, while 3840 Hz PWM dimming aims to ease eye strain in dark environments. Brightness is rated at 1300 nits in high-brightness mode and up to 5000 nits at peak for HDR highlights, so outdoor visibility and HDR content should both look punchy. The 90.1% screen-to-body ratio makes the front feel modern and immersive.

Performance and Software

Under the hood sits the Qualcomm Snapdragon 7 Gen 4 (4 nm) with an octa-core CPU (1×2.8 GHz Cortex-720, 4×2.4 GHz Cortex-720, 3×1.8 GHz Cortex-520) and an Adreno 722 GPU. That should comfortably handle social apps, multitasking, and most mainstream games at high settings. RAM and storage scale from 256 GB / 12 GB to 512 GB / 16 GB, using UFS 2.2 storage. Out of the box it runs Android 15 with OriginOS 5, vivo’s polished skin that emphasizes animations and gesture navigation.

Camera System and Imaging

The rear setup is the headline. A 50 MP, f/1.9 main sensor (1/1.56″) with OIS and PDAF leads the trio, paired with a 50 MP, f/2.7 periscope telephoto offering 3x optical zoom and OIS, plus an 8 MP, f/2.2 ultrawide with a 106-degree field of view. A ring-LED flash, panorama, and HDR round out the modes. Video recording tops out at 4K with gyro-EIS stabilization. On the front, a 50 MP, f/2.0 selfie camera with autofocus also records 4K, which is unusual at this price.

Battery Life and Charging

A 6500 mAh silicon-carbon (Si/C) Li-Ion battery is the standout endurance feature. Silicon-carbon chemistry lets vivo fit more capacity in a thinner shell without adding weight, and 192 g for a 6500 mAh phone is impressive. Charging is rated at 90 W wired, with USB Power Delivery, reverse wired charging, and bypass charging for gaming sessions. There is no wireless charging listed.

Connectivity and Extras

The S30 supports 5G SA/NSA across a wide band list, plus Wi-Fi 6 (dual-band), Bluetooth 5.4 with aptX Adaptive, aptX Lossless, and LHDC 5 for higher-quality wireless audio. Positioning covers GPS, Galileo, GLONASS, QZSS, and BDS. NFC and an infrared port are included, the latter handy as a universal remote. USB is Type-C 2.0 with OTG, but there is no 3.5 mm jack and no FM radio. Stereo speakers handle media playback, and an in-display optical fingerprint sensor manages biometrics.

Value for Money

For about 330 EUR, the combination of a periscope telephoto, a 6500 mAh battery, a 5000-nit peak AMOLED, and 90 W charging is hard to match. Trade-offs include UFS 2.2 storage rather than UFS 3.1 or 4.0, plastic side rails, and the absence of wireless charging. Buyers prioritizing zoom photography, battery life, and a bright display get a strong package at this price point.
